BRANCH COUNTY, MI (WTVB) – Freezing rain and icy road conditions led to another round of school closings in Branch County on Tuesday.
After not using any snow days until January 9, it was the fifth time in two weeks that classes were scrubbed by administrators because of bad weather.
Some government offices and businesses opened a couple of hours late as the freezing rain led to ice accumulations and difficult travel conditions.
The cold ground temperatures caused secondary and untreated roads to become icy and very slippery. Pavement temperatures were expected to rise above freezing later on Tuesday which would allow travel conditions to improve.
Sidewalks, driveways and other paved surfaces have also become icy and should be used with extreme caution.
